After marveling at the Clérigos Church, the tour group then heads to the iconic São Bento Railway Station, a stunning Beaux-Arts edifice renowned for its intricate azulejo tile panels.

Opened in 1903, the station features a grand entrance hall with over 20,000 hand-painted azulejo tiles depicting scenes from Portuguese history.

The opulent interior showcases the country’s rich artistic heritage, with detailed murals and intricate carvings adorning the walls and ceiling.

Visitors can marvel at the station’s imposing granite exterior, which exemplifies the Beaux-Arts style popular in late 19th-century Europe.

The station’s central location makes it a vital transportation hub, connecting Porto to the rest of the country by rail.

Beyond its functional role, São Bento is a beloved architectural gem that captivates all who pass through its halls.

The tour’s inclusion of a visit to the Casa do Infante, an architecturally significant 14th-century structure, allows visitors to explore the city’s medieval history and heritage.

This historic building, originally constructed as a royal residence, now houses a museum that showcases Porto’s evolution from a medieval trading port to a modern urban center.

During the tour, guests can wander through the Casa do Infante’s well-preserved interiors, admiring its Gothic architectural features and learning about the site’s pivotal role in the city’s development.
